What does PFAD mean?
Principal For A Day (PFAD) is an event that offers community members the opportunity to spend time with a principal. It is designed to increase awareness and understanding in the business community of the strengths and challenges of local schools, as well as form partnerships and collaboration between schools and local businesses.
